experiment: ignore SIGCHLD
This commit is contained in:
parent
03c0c0401e
commit
4cfee4c454
@ -8,9 +8,15 @@ use std::fs::OpenOptions;
|
||||
use std::process::Command;
|
||||
use std::env;
|
||||
use rand::Rng;
|
||||
use nix::sys::signal;
|
||||
|
||||
fn main() -> Result<(), Box<dyn Error>> {
|
||||
let args: Vec<String> = env::args().collect();
|
||||
|
||||
unsafe {
|
||||
signal::signal(signal::Signal::SIGCHLD, signal::SigHandler::SigIgn)
|
||||
}.unwrap();
|
||||
|
||||
let mut rng = rand::thread_rng();
|
||||
|
||||
let log_path = env::var("LOG_PATH")?;
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user